WOLLEMI PINE. Info

Latin Name: Wollemi Nobilis.

Common Name:  Wollemi Pine.

Origin: New South Wales, Australia.

Hardiness: -12.

Growth:  Amazing and rare. Evergreen. Leaves are flat and arranged in a spiral. Bark is dark green and nobbly. Can sprout multiple trunks.

Sun: Sun/Partial shade.

Exposure: Exposed/sheltered.

Soil:  Acidic. Requires good drainage.

Moisture: Water regularly when new shoots appear from may-June then re-water only when soil is almost dry. Do not over-water.

If planting out, best planted above soil line

    The Wollemi Pine is an amazing plant and is one of the world’s oldest and rarest. Classed as a ‘Living Fossil’ it dates back to the time of the dinosaurs.

    Only discovered growing in 1994 in New South Wales in Australia the oldest fossil of the Wollemi has been dated to 200 million years ago. Conservation wise, it is rated as Critically endangered.

    The Wollemi is a majestic and very attractive conifer with unusual dark green foliage arranged in a spiral formation. It,s bark is distinctive and is dark brown and knobbly. It can also sprout multiple trunks.

    An ultimate survivor it can adapt to a diverse range of climates, is not easily damaged in high winds and trials have indicated it will survive temperatures down to -12 degrees.

    Attractive and striking in appearance, it can make a spectacular specimen tree.

    Easy to grow, but prefers well drained soils.
